Mobility Ramp Construction in Kansas City, KS

Mobility ramp construction services focus on creating accessible pathways that help individuals navigate entryways, stairs, and uneven surfaces with ease. These projects typically include building ramps for residential properties, such as front or back entrances, as well as for garages, porches, or decks. Property owners often seek these services to improve safety, meet accessibility needs, or enhance the overall functionality of their homes, especially when accommodating mobility devices like wheelchairs, walkers, or scooters.

Before requesting mobility ramp construction, property owners usually want to understand the types of materials used, the design options available, and the specific measurements needed to ensure proper fit and safety. It's also helpful to consider the location of the ramp, the slope or incline requirements, and any local building codes or regulations that might influence the project. Clarifying these details can assist in planning a solution that enhances accessibility while fitting seamlessly into the property's layout.

FAQ

Mobility Ramp Construction Questions

What types of properties can benefit from mobility ramp construction? Residential homes, apartment buildings, and commercial properties can all improve accessibility with custom ramps.

What are common reasons to add a mobility ramp? To enhance safety, meet accessibility needs, or comply with regulations for property access.

What materials are typically used for mobility ramps? Durable options like aluminum, wood, and concrete are commonly used to ensure stability and longevity.

What should property owners consider before installing a ramp? The location, slope requirements, and specific accessibility needs are important factors in planning the project.
